    Problem/error when trying to scan

    When i try to scan via TWAIN Adobe PhotoDeluxe , one or more types of the following error message may appear .
    # " Can not satisfy your request because the scanner is not installed ".
    # "Can not satisfy your request because of an error scan" .
    # " Unable to initialize TWAIN. Make sure Twain.dll is installed in the Windows directory " .
    # " Can not satisfy your request because the acquisition module has an error " .

    Please help. I am using HP scanner 3770.

    The operating principle of a scanner is as follows:

    * The scan through the document line by line;
    * Each line is broken down into " basic issues " , correspond to pixels .
    * A sensor analyzes the color of each pixel ;
    * The color of each pixel is decomposed into three components ( red, green , blue) ;
    * Each color component is measured and represented by a value. For quantification of 8 bits , each component has a value between 0 and 255.

    Before performing the following procedure, make sure your scanner (or your multifunction device with scanning capabilities ) is connected to the computer and turned on .
    1. Place a document on the scanner or , if it includes a tray, place one or more pages in the tray. If your scanner is equipped with two options, use one of your choice.
    2. Click All programs, click Windows Fax and Scan.
    3. To use the Scan mode in the lower left pane , click Scanning.
    4. In the toolbar , click Rescan.
    5. In the dialog box on the list of Profiles Then click Documents. The default settings for scanning a document , you can use or alter automatically displayed .
    6. To see how a document will appear when scanned , click Survey. If necessary, adjust your scan settings , then view a preview of the new document . Repeat this step until you are satisfied with the results displayed in the preview.
    7. Click Scan. Once the scan is complete , Windows Fax and Scan automatically displays the document to allow you to view and manage it.

    You can crop an image before the scan by clicking on Survey in the dialog box Rescan Then, in the preview area , dragging the handles of the cutting tool to resize the image. If you scan the page contains multiple images , you can save each image in a separate file by selecting the checkbox Browse or scan images as separate files.

    If you frequently scan documents or files and you want to organize them, you can create folders in Scan Mode . In the left pane , right -click on a folder , then click New Folder. To copy or move a scanned document to a folder, right click on the document, click Move to FolderThen select the folder you want to move . You can automatically forward scanned documents to an email address or network folder. To choose a forwarding option , click Tools Then click Routing Analysis.
